This module explores communication patterns in relation to quality assessment and interaction with people living with dementia. Communication is a dynamic, ongoing process that has varying levels of complexity. Effective communication skills are essential in order to elicit accurate and complete data from clients. The module is designed to assist development of rapport and relationship building with people with dementia and their carers.
Describe the key issues and considerations in the care of people living with dementia. Implement person-centred and evidence based care for people with dementia
